Balance therapy tailored with changed visual cues for neuropathy
Part of Brain & nervous system clinical trials.
This study tests a balance-retraining program that uses modified visual information to help people with neuropathy feel steadier while walking. You may benefit if your balance problems are linked to nerve-related sensitivity and you can safely participate in walking and standing exercises.

Who can take part
- You’re an adult (age 18 or older).
- You have chronic acquired neuropathy affecting nerves (demyelinating type).
- You can walk 20 meters indoors without another person helping you (technical aids are allowed).
- You have ongoing balance problems or discomfort related to reduced sensation (sensitivity issues).
- Your condition has been stable for at least 2 months, even if you’re still on usual treatments.
- You live in the Paris area (Île de France) and can consent to join the study.
